Description

The BTA12-600BWRG is a type of triac, which is a semiconductor device commonly used for switching and controlling AC power. It belongs to the BTA series, featuring a rated voltage of 600V and a current rating of 12A. This device is used in various applications, including motor control, lighting systems, and heating devices.
The triac operates by allowing current to flow in both directions when triggered, making it suitable for AC circuits. It features a gate that can be triggered with a small control current, enabling it to turn on at a specific point in the AC cycle.
The BTA12-600BWRG is notable for its robust construction, which allows it to withstand high surge currents and thermal stresses. It is encapsulated in a standard TO-220 package for easy mounting and heat dissipation.
Overall, the BTA12-600BWRG is a versatile and reliable choice for electronic circuits requiring efficient AC power control.

Pinout

The BTA12-600BWRG is a triac used for controlling AC power. It has a total of three pins. The pin configuration and their functions are as follows:
1. MT1 (Main Terminal 1): This pin is connected to the load and typically serves as the output terminal.
2. MT2 (Main Terminal 2): This pin is also connected to the load but is used to control the current flow through the triac.
3. G (Gate): This pin is used to trigger the triac. When a small current is applied to the gate, it allows a larger current to flow between MT1 and MT2.
The BTA12-600BWRG is rated for 12A and 600V, making it suitable for various applications in AC switching and control.
